Flyone and Air Moldova resume regular flights

Flyone and Air Moldova restarted the regular flights on July 1. The regular flights operated by Air Moldova to Salonic, Larnaca, Nisa and Berlin remain suspended in July. The announcements were placed on airlines’ websites, IPN reports.

Flyone said tickets can be booked until next March at prices that start from €39, with all taxes included. The prices for members of Flyone Club start from €34.

Flyone operates flights to 14 destinations (Frankfurt, Tel Aviv, St. Petersburg, London, Moscow, Parma, Verona, Dublin, Lisbon, Paris, Antalya, Heraklion, Sharm El-Sheikh, and Bodrum), ten regular flights and four charter flights.

Air Moldova resumes regular flights to and from Moscow, St. Petersburg, Frankfurt, Tel Aviv, Istanbul, London, Paris, Dublin, Milan, Roma, Verona, Bologna, and Lisbon. The flights to and from Krasnodar will become available on July 11.

Atât Flyone and Air Moldova recommend the passengers to inform themselves about the restrictions imposed by the country to which they intend to travel before buying a ticket.
